Worker Safety in Hazardous Medical Disposal Waste

Handling medical disposal waste poses a significant risk to healthcare workers if not managed correctly. Exposure to infectious agents, toxic chemicals, and sharp instruments can lead to serious injuries or illnesses. Protecting staff while maintaining efficient waste management systems requires a robust framework of safety protocols, training, and regulatory compliance. Ensuring worker safety is not just a legal requirement; it’s an essential component of fostering a safe and responsible healthcare environment. Proper handling of medical disposal waste also safeguards patients and the wider community, preventing environmental contamination and the spread of disease.

Healthcare institutions must prioritise the implementation of structured programmes that emphasise both personal protection and procedural compliance. From the moment waste is generated, every step—from segregation to disposal—demands careful attention and adherence to guidelines. By embedding safety as a core organisational value, healthcare facilities can significantly reduce workplace incidents, build staff confidence, and align with South African legal standards for medical waste management.


Personal Protective Equipment (PPE)
Personal Protective Equipment (PPE) is fundamental in shielding healthcare workers from the dangers of medical disposal waste. Gloves, masks, gowns, and eye protection create barriers against infectious agents, chemical contaminants, and toxic substances. Proper selection, fitting, and disposal of PPE are critical, as compromised or incorrectly used equipment can expose staff to serious hazards. Regular training on PPE use ensures that workers can respond effectively to high-risk situations while maintaining comfort and mobility during long shifts.

Beyond basic usage, PPE protocols must include inspection and maintenance to ensure ongoing effectiveness. Contaminated or damaged PPE can increase the likelihood of exposure, making rigorous adherence to replacement schedules and cleaning standards essential. Healthcare facilities must also ensure sufficient PPE supplies and accessible storage to guarantee readiness at all times. In combination with other safety measures, consistent PPE use significantly mitigates risks associated with medical disposal waste handling.


Training and Education
Continuous staff education is vital for safe medical disposal waste handling. Workers need to understand the hazards, segregation techniques, emergency procedures, and proper disposal methods. Structured training programmes not only build awareness but also reinforce safe behavioural practices in high-risk environments. Regular refresher courses and scenario-based exercises ensure that healthcare personnel remain competent and confident in dealing with potential hazards.

Training should also encompass the evolving regulations and technological advancements in medical waste management. Staff must be aware of new disposal equipment, automated systems, and chemical neutralisation techniques. Education initiatives contribute to a culture of safety where personnel feel empowered to identify hazards, report incidents, and adopt best practices. This knowledge-driven approach is central to protecting both workers and the environment from risks associated with medical disposal waste.


Waste Segregation Practices
Segregation of medical disposal waste is a primary strategy for reducing occupational and environmental risk. Distinguishing between infectious, chemical, sharps, and radioactive waste ensures that each category is treated using the most appropriate and safest method. Colour-coded bins, clear labelling, and strict adherence to segregation protocols prevent cross-contamination and simplify subsequent disposal processes.

Effective segregation requires consistency and oversight. Staff must be trained to recognise waste categories and understand the consequences of improper handling. Mismanagement can lead to serious injuries, contamination, or regulatory penalties. Implementing regular audits and accountability measures encourages compliance and fosters a safety-conscious culture. Clear segregation practices, combined with proper disposal, form the backbone of responsible management of medical disposal waste.


Safe Handling of Sharps
Sharps are one of the most hazardous components of medical disposal waste, including needles, scalpels, and other pointed instruments. To reduce injury risk, sharps must be placed immediately into puncture-resistant containers that are clearly labelled and securely closed. Direct handling of needles or blades should be avoided, and designated disposal routines must be strictly followed to prevent accidental exposure.

Healthcare facilities should also provide ergonomically designed sharps containers and ensure that they are accessible at points of use. Overfilled or improperly sealed containers increase the likelihood of injuries. Combining proper storage, handling, and disposal of sharps with continuous staff training creates a comprehensive safety net for workers managing medical disposal waste.


Decontamination Procedures
Decontamination is essential for maintaining a safe working environment when handling medical disposal waste. Equipment, surfaces, and work areas must be cleaned using validated methods to neutralise pathogens and remove chemical residues. Routine decontamination reduces the risk of cross-infection and ensures that reusable instruments meet hygiene standards before further use.

Workplace policies should specify the frequency, techniques, and chemicals suitable for decontamination. Staff must be trained to follow protocols accurately, including correct dilution, contact times, and disposal of cleaning residues. Integrating thorough decontamination with PPE usage and proper waste segregation forms a multilayered protection system against hazards associated with medical disposal waste.


Incident Reporting Systems
Prompt reporting of injuries, spills, or exposure incidents is critical for timely response and long-term safety improvements. A structured incident reporting system allows healthcare managers to investigate causes, implement corrective actions, and maintain records for regulatory compliance. Staff should be trained to recognise reportable events and to act immediately, minimising risks to themselves and colleagues.

The reporting system also enables trend analysis, helping facilities identify recurring hazards and evaluate the effectiveness of current safety protocols. Coupled with regular audits and feedback, this approach strengthens institutional safety culture and reduces the incidence of accidents associated with medical disposal waste.


Ergonomic Safety
Ergonomic considerations are often overlooked in medical disposal waste handling. Workers frequently lift, move, or process heavy containers, leading to musculoskeletal injuries if proper techniques are not followed. Ergonomic training focuses on correct lifting, posture, and equipment use to prevent strain and long-term injury.

Facilities can further enhance safety by providing adjustable trolleys, lift-assist devices, and designated storage areas. Combining ergonomic strategies with comprehensive staff training reduces injury risk, improves efficiency, and maintains workforce health in medical disposal waste operations.


Vaccination and Health Monitoring
Healthcare workers are often exposed to pathogens present in medical disposal waste, making immunisation and regular health monitoring essential. Vaccination against hepatitis, tetanus, and other relevant infections provides a critical layer of protection. Periodic health check-ups ensure early detection of occupational illness and reinforce preventive measures.

Facilities must establish health surveillance programmes, track immunisation status, and provide access to medical consultations for exposed workers. These measures not only safeguard individual staff but also contribute to overall workplace safety and regulatory compliance for medical disposal waste handling.


Emergency Response Plans
Accidental exposures, chemical spills, or other emergencies require a well-defined response plan. Rapid containment, evacuation, and medical treatment protocols must be clearly communicated to all staff. Drills and scenario-based training help ensure preparedness, reducing response times and limiting health risks.

Emergency plans should include contact details for medical support, clear roles for team members, and post-incident evaluation procedures. Integrating these protocols with PPE use, decontamination procedures, and reporting systems creates a resilient safety framework for managing medical disposal waste.


Regulatory Compliance
Adherence to South African laws, local regulations, and international guidelines is fundamental for safe medical disposal waste handling. Compliance ensures that healthcare facilities meet occupational health standards, protect the environment, and avoid legal penalties. Facilities should regularly review policies and updates to maintain alignment with regulatory expectations.

A culture of compliance also reinforces accountability and ensures that safety protocols are consistently applied. By integrating legal requirements with practical safety measures such as PPE, training, and waste segregation, healthcare facilities can effectively manage risks associated with medical disposal waste.
